Hello,

 

I've been trying to get both of my speakers working, but I'm only getting sound from one speaker. Now, I've seen other posts where people mention that you need a mono track for guitar, but I tried this and I'm either doing it wrong or thats not the problem. I've opened other projects that would play through both speakers (while I was recording them) but now they're only playing through one speaker.

Open a new empty project. Create one audio track. Open the Loop Browser. Preview an Apple Loop, any Apple Loop.

 

Do you hear sound from both speakers?

 

 

No I drag and dropped a loop into the audio track and it still only came from the one speaker.

Then it sounds like your issue is unrelated to Logic? What if you watch a YouTube video, do you hear audio from only one speaker? As suggested, check your wiring, your speakers, your audio device setup (what audio interface are you using?)... you could always swap the Left and Right speakers to check that they work properly.
